Details of IFSC Code for Indusind Bank, Panchkula Sector 9, Panchkula
Here are the key points that are associated with the IFSC Code INDB0000164 of Indusind Bank for its branch located in Panchkula, within the district of Panchkula in the state of Haryana.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Indusind Bank |
| IFSC Code | INDB0000164 |
| Branch | Panchkula Sector 9 |
| City | Panchkula |
| District | Panchkula |
| State | Haryana |
| Address | Sco-P, Sector 9, Panchkula -134109 , Haryana |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, which is an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Indusind Bank located in Panchkula Sector 9, Panchkula, Haryana, is provided a unique IFSC like INDB0000164 so that their online payments reach the right place.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ely recognizes the Indusind Bank branch in Panchkula.
- Hel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Panchkula and Panchkula.
- It reduces most of the errors in fund transfers and makes sure its accuracy.
- It enables s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.

Format of the IFSC Code INDB0000164
This is the format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Indusind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the explanation: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): This is the bank code. For Indusind Bank, these characters are the bank's short identifier.
- 5th character (0): This stays zero till there is any future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are specific branch code assigned to branches such as Panchkula Sector 9 in Panchkula.
For example, the IFSC Code INDB0000164 of Indusind Bank for the Panchkula Sector 9 bran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Panchkula and Haryana accurately.
